The typical American commute has been getting longer each year since 2010. The average one-way commute in Wakpala (zip 57658) takes 21.0 minutes. That's shorter than the US average of 26.4 minutes.
How people in Wakpala (zip 57658) get to work:
- 78.8% drive their own car alone
- 10.6% carpool with others
- 7.7% work from home
- 0.0% take mass transit
